Aspire Health Alliance, formerly South Shore Mental Health, is helping to pioneer a new approach to behavioral health across the lifespan providing a continuum of care that is proactive, coordinated, available through multiple access points and integrated with medical care.

Social Thinking is a cross-curriculum intervention that cultivates self-regulation, adaptability, and social success. Social Thinking uses a specific set of terms throughout the school day that help students understand difficult concepts, like differing points-of-view or hard-to-describe feelings.
